This closes #587
Project: http://git-wip-us.apache.org/repos/asf/incubator-brooklyn/repo Commit: http://git-wip-us.apache.org/repos/asf/incubator-brooklyn/commit/cecaaf02 Tree: http://git-wip-us.apache.org/repos/asf/incubator-brooklyn/tree/cecaaf02 Diff: http://git-wip-us.apache.org/repos/asf/incubator-brooklyn/diff/cecaaf02 Branch: refs/heads/master Commit: cecaaf02bfef1a2dba428be37a2a66eeab57b23d Parents: 4f1eb45 1f6731e Author: Aled Sage <[email protected]> Authored: Sun Apr 12 16:40:15 2015 -0500 Committer: Aled Sage <[email protected]> Committed: Sun Apr 12 16:40:15 2015 -0500 ---------------------------------------------------------------------- .../BrooklynAssemblyTemplateInstantiator.java | 52 ++-- .../BrooklynComponentTemplateResolver.java | 238 ++++++++----------- .../BrooklynEntityDecorationResolver.java | 6 +- .../creation/ChefComponentTemplateResolver.java | 57 ----- .../service/BrooklynServiceTypeResolver.java | 72 ++++++ .../service/CatalogServiceTypeResolver.java | 78 ++++++ .../service/ChefServiceTypeResolver.java | 62 +++++ .../service/JavaServiceTypeResolver.java | 39 +++ .../creation/service/ServiceTypeResolver.java | 73 ++++++ ...lyn.spi.creation.service.ServiceTypeResolver | 22 ++ 10 files changed, 480 insertions(+), 219 deletions(-) ----------------------------------------------------------------------
